Ockendon Station, managed by c2c, offers an array of amenities to ensure passenger comfort and convenience. The ticket office operates from 06:30 to 11:05 on weekdays, and 08:55 to 13:30 on Saturdays. The station is equipped with ticket machines, including accessible ones, for easy collection of tickets purchased online. Smartcard validators are present, though smartcards aren’t issued here.
Accessibility is a priority with features such as step-free access, though it’s limited to platform 1. Acc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and a ramp for train access are also available. There are accessible toilets on Platform 1, which require a RADAR key. However, facilities like refreshment outlets, ATMs, and baby changing rooms are not available at this station.
For onward travel, Ockendon Station offers several transportation links. In case of rail disruptions, replacement buses operate from the bus stop outside the station, and there’s an arrangement for ticket acceptance on the TfL 370 Bus to Lakeside and Romford. At Ford Station, ticket purchasing is straightforward and accessible. The ticket office operates from 06:30 to 13:05 Monday to Saturday, providing services such as ticket collection from machines. Convenience is at the forefront with ticket machines that acc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ring inclusivity for all travelers. However, potential visitors should note that while the ticket machines are accessible, the station’s layout may present challenges for those requiring step-free access.
Key facilities include a help point and customer services available until early afternoon on weekdays and Saturdays, making travel as hassle-free as possible. For added security and assistance, Ford Station is equipped with CCTV and help points across platforms. While there are no waiting rooms, a seating area is available for those who need to rest before their journey. However, take note that amenities for refreshments, ATMs, and shops are not available on site, emphasizing the need to plan ahead.
For those who may need special assistance, Ford Station offers several services to facilitate an inclusive experience. Though step-free access is mainly available, some areas use steep ramps. Staff-operated ramps can assist in boarding, while help points offer immediate contact with assistance teams ready to coordinate your travel needs. With wheelchairs available on site and no barriers complicating entry, Ford strives to cater to all visitors, though advance contact for assistance is recommended by Southern Railway's Assisted Travel service.
